The GE IC698PSA100 module is a power supply module designed for use with GE Fanuc RX7i series programmable logic controllers (PLCs).

**Product Name:**

GE IC698PSA100 Power Supply Module

**Product Description:**

The GE IC698PSA100 is a single-slot, rack-mounted power supply module designed to provide reliable power to RX7i PLC systems. It offers high efficiency and robust performance, ensuring stable operation of the control system in various industrial environments. **Product Parameters / Specifications:**

– Input Voltage: 85-264 VAC, 50/60 Hz or 125-250 VDC
– Output Voltage: 24 VDC
– Output Current: 10 A
– Power Consumption: 115W maximum
– Operating Temperature: 0 to 60°C (32 to 140°F)
– Storage Temperature: -40 to 70°C (-40 to 158°F)
– Humidity: 5% to 95% non-condensing
– Dimensions (HxWxD): 3.42 x 1.42 x 8.39 in (87 x 36 x 213 mm)
– Weight: 1.5 lbs (0.68 kg) approximately

**Product Use:**

The GE IC698PSA100 power supply module is used to provide regulated DC power to various modules within the RX7i PLC system, including CPU modules, I/O modules, and communication modules. It ensures that the PLC operates reliably and consistently, even under demanding industrial conditions.
